History and Context
+1770-00-00T00:00:00Z marks the founding of Löhrs Garten[13]. Owners include Johann Georg Keil[5], a writer[17], 1781–1857[18], of Germany[19]; Adolph Keil[6], a Legationsrat[20], 1822–1890[21], of Kingdom of Saxony[22]; Leipziger Immobiliengesellschaft[7]; Eberhard Heinrich Löhr[8], a politician[23], 1725–1798[24], of Germany[25]; Carl Eberhard Löhr[9], a banker[26], 1763–1813[27]; and Juliane Wilhelmine Bause[10], a draftsperson[28], 1768–1837[29].
